Transaction 0876c31b8feb903108767e2a2c3c6c10878963203191fccdedd7d5d65066164b

2 Input
1 Outputs
  • 0876c31b8feb903108767e2a2c3c6c10878963203191fccdedd7d5d65066164b:0
  • value  457988
    address  17H2f1Ed9MG5EU2ttBBpKpC6L8iNkBDkAP